Find the mass of 2 moles of nitrogen atoms.

उत्तर
Given moles on N atom = 2 moles
Gram atomic mass of nitrogen atoms = 14g
Therefore, 14g of nitrogen atoms = 1 mole of nitrogen atoms
So, 2 moles of nitrogen atoms = 14 × 2g of nitrogen atoms
Hence, 2 moles of nitrogen atoms weigh 28g.
